Abstract
An exercise support apparatus comprising acquiring unit for acquiring first information representative of at least one of an exercise experience and physical fitness of a user, storing unit for storing a plurality of kinds of exercises, exercise selecting unit configured to select at least one of the exercises stored in the storing unit, and at least one break; and exercise menu generating unit configured to generate an exercise menu including the selected exercises and the at least one break based on the acquired first information by the acquiring unit.

9. A non-transitory computer readable storage medium recording a program to be executed by the computer, the program causing a computer to perform steps comprising:
-
acquiring first information representative of at least one of an exercise experience and physical fitness of a user; storing a plurality of kinds of exercises which includes at least one of an aerobic exercise and at least one of an anaerobic exercise; selecting a plurality of exercises which includes a plurality of aerobic exercises and a plurality of the anaerobic exercises stored in the storing unit, and a plurality of breaks; generating an exercise menu, including the plurality of selected exercises and the plurality of breaks; and determining a ratio between each of break times of the breaks included in the exercise menu, and each of exercise times of the aerobic exercises and the anaerobic exercises relative to the breaks, on the basis of the first information; determining the ratio between the aerobic exercise time of the plurality of aerobic exercises selected by the exercise selecting unit, and the break time of at least one of the plurality of breaks, on the basis of the exercise experience information acquired by the acquiring unit; determining the ratio between the anaerobic exercise time of the anaerobic exercises selected by the exercise selecting unit, and the break time of at least one of plurality of breaks, on the basis of the physical fitness information acquired by the acquiring unit; and generating a circuit exercise menu based on the plurality of selected exercises, the plurality of breaks and the ratios determined by the exercise ratio determining unit.
